Meet John Boyega: The British Actor Just Cast In 'Star Wars: Episode VII'

_john-boyega_
The actual cast of "Star Wars: Episode VII" had been just announced.

While numerous actors will reprise their roles, including Carrie Fisher, Harrison Ford and also Mark Hamill, the film are going to be filled with new superstars including John Boyega.

The 22-year-old British actor is better known for playing Moses within 2011's teenager monster film, "Attack The Block. "

He was also featured within Spike Lee's 2011 TV movie "Da Brick. " Next, he'll appear in Fox's forthcoming miniseries "24: Live Another day. "

Boyega was extensively rumored to star as the lead within "Episode VII. " He had been reportedly up against other young celebrities including Jesse Plemons by TV hits "Breaking Bad" and also "Friday Night Lights. "

Boyega's exact role within the film is even now unknown.

He will star alongside an additional newcomer, Daisy Ridley, as well as Adam Driver ("Girls") and also Oscar Isaac ("Inside Llewyn Davis").

The casting associated with both Boyega and also Ridley fits as well as J. J. Abrams' rumored decision to would like to cast relative unknowns.

This follows the actual casting decisions of the original film, “Star Wars: Episode IV — A New Hope” that cast relative unknowns Carrie Fisher, Mark Hamill, and also Harrison Ford.

The "Star Wars: Episode VII" is slated for a December 18, 2015 release.
